LONDON, August 31st. The Times Correspondent at Stockholm states that Duke Adolf Friedrich of “ASAHU BEER.” CUTLER PALMER & CO. Alecklinburg-Schwervin has refused the throne of Finland, owing to lack of unanimity in favour of the establishment of a monarchy, and also to the stringent restriction of the Sovereign's authority. LONDON, August 31st.

A Royal Commission has been been appointed under the Chairmanship of Lord Emmott to investigate the advis ability of adopting a decimal- coinage in the United Kingdom."

GERMAN STATES REBUKED.

AMSTERDAM August 31st. The manifestation of the intention of the German states, notably Bavaria and Saxony, to assert themselves by appoint ing their own diplomatic representatives at Sofa and elsewhere has evoked a strong rebuke from the Fossische Zeitung. AMERICA'S 'MAN-POWER BILL

WASHINGTON, August 31st. Congress has passed the Man Power Bill extending the draft age limits from eighteen to forty-five...

ALLIED AND ENEMY CREDIT IN SCANDINAVIA

STOCKHOLM, August 31st, A striking testimony to the difference between the Allied and enemy credit in Scandinavia is afforded by the fact that the pound sterling is now quoted. at 73 per cent. of its normal value, the dollar 77 per cent, and the franc 70, while the Austriag kroner is only 35 per cent. and the German mark is.50.

LONDON, August 31st. Germany is already adopting familar method of colonisation Esthonia.

The schools are being. Ger manised and Eathonian music bidden.
